Default how do i change the selected cells color

When i select cells in exel 2007 i don´t see the color it´s almost withe can
it be changed ?

Default how do i change the selected cells color

Put the following macro in worksheet code:

Private Sub Worksheet_SelectionChange(ByVal Target As Range)
Cells.Interior.ColorIndex = xlNone
Target.Interior.ColorIndex = 6
End Sub
